Output 68bde66e844b70f719da4db3d69987031a16156d673fbc5987081950e306fc69:0

value
39408868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0ca922a55fc30cb147da138b05a54128da082e9 OP_EQUALVERIFY OP_CHECKSIG
address
1L2zDn76GEsz3GoWrkJ5h5psyr8E34BkAh
transaction
68bde66e844b70f719da4db3d69987031a16156d673fbc5987081950e306fc69
spent
true